However, developing these complex software systems is often slow, resource-intensive, and difficult to automate. While current AI-enabled coding assistants accelerate human task completion, they are limited to smaller, isolated tasks like function completion, and struggle with the scale and contextual demands of building an entire software system from the ground up. </p>\r\r<h2>The Technology: AI-driven workflow for rapidly generating custom operating systems</h2>\r\r<p>This technology describes a method called “Task Prompting,” which enables a human developer to effectively collaborate with a large language model (LLM) to generate a complete and functional operating system (OS) kernel. These prompts iteratively guide the LLM in creating all necessary C++ and assembly code for OS functionality on new hardware. This technology supports multi-process user application, virtual memory, systems calls, networking, and persistent storage. </p>\r\r<p>This technology was successfully used to generate a high-performance OS kernel that can run on unmodified Linux applications with performance comparable to native Linux.</p>\r\r<h2>Applications:</h2>\r\r<ul>\r<li>Rapid prototyping for IoT devices, robotics, and custom computer hardware</li>\r<li>Creation of custom operating systems for embedded systems</li>\r<li>AI-powered developer tools</li>\r<li>AI-tools for advanced educational platforms</li>\r<li>Enterprise software</li>\r<li>Computer engineering research model development</li>\r</ul>\r\r<h2>Advantages:</h2>\r\r<ul>\r<li>Rapid generation of working OS kernel</li>\r<li>Iterative process for creating, refining, and debugging codebase with large language models (LLMs)</li>\r<li>Supports multi-process user applications, virtual memory, system calls, networking, and persistent storage</li>\r<li>Utilizes structured methodology for human-AI interactions</li>\r</ul>\r\r<h2>Lead Inventor:</h2>\r\r<p><a href=\"https://www.engineering.columbia.edu/faculty-staff/directory/jason-nieh\">Jason Nieh, Ph.D.</a></p>\r\r<h2>Patent Information:</h2>\r\r<p>Patent Pending</p>\r\r<h2>Related Publications:</h2>\r\r<h2>Tech Ventures Reference:</h2>\r\r<ul>\r<li><p>IR CU25381</p></li>\r<li><p>Licensing Contact: <a href=\"mailto:techtransfer@columbia.edu\">Greg Maskel</a> </p></li>\r</ul>\r","tags":["Artificial intelligence","Assembly language","Computer engineering","Computer hardware","Embedded system","Enterprise software","Internet of things","Language model","Linux kernel","Operating system","Rapid prototyping","Virtual memory","Workflow"],"file_number":"CU25381","collections":[],"meta_description":"AI-driven workflow rapidly generates custom OS kernels via structured prompts, enabling fast, multi-process, networked, persistent systems.","apriori_judge_output":"{\"scores\":{\"novelty\":4.0,\"potential_impact\":5.0,\"readiness\":4.0,\"scalability\":4.0,\"timeliness\":4.0},\"weighted_score\":4.2,\"risks\":[\"High reliance on LLMs may introduce security and correctness risks\",\"Potential for patentability challenges due to broad AI-assisted code generation\",\"Competition from established OS development tooling\",\"Ethical/dual-use considerations for OS-level modifications\"],\"one_sentence_take\":\"Strong novelty and impact with near-term readiness, but faces AI safety, security, and integration risks that should be mitigated before scaling.\"}","inventors":["Jason Nieh"],"manager":"Greg Maskel","depts":["Computer Science"],"divs":["Fu Foundation School of Engineering and Applied Science (SEAS)"],"date_released":"2026-07-24"},"highlight":{},"matched_queries":null,"score":0.0}
